While practically all Sonoma State students are well familiar with the Seawolf, of course, the mascot that students of the university are proud to call their own, many may not know the man responsible for its inspiration. The famed Sonoma County author Jack London, who is known for his famous books such as “Call of the Wild,” “White Fang,” and of course “The Seawolf,” is at the forefront of a new university art exhibit on the second floor of the Sonoma State Library; for students, it is certainly a place to explore.
